Patchwerk by David Tallerman

(0 reviews)
3.99 USD
Fleeing the city of New York on the TransContinental atmospheric transport vehicle, Dran Florrian is traveling with Palimpsest-the ultimate proof of a lifetime of scientific theorizing.

When a rogue organization attempts to steal the device, however, Dran takes drastic action.

But his invention threatens to destroy the very fabric of this and all other possible universes, unless Dran-or someone very much like him-can shut down the machine and reverse the process.

Praise for this book

"Tallerman (the Tales of Easie Damasco comic fantasy series) deftly pulls his characters through multiple quick changes in identity, location, and possible futures, always keeping the plot and action unbroken so the dizzying shifts never become confusing. He throws open a surreal and suspenseful hall of science fiction mirrors, and readers will enjoy watching Florrian smash through them all." — Publishers Weekly

"This story is like an onion, with layer upon layer of complex worlds, just waiting to be explored, and at its heart is a scientist that hopes his work will be used for the benefit of mankind, and will do anything to make sure it’s not used for nefarious means...This is a bite sized morsel of sci-fi, but it sure is a tasty one." — SF Signal




About the AuthorDavid Tallerman is the author of the Tales of Easie Damasco fantasy trilogy, the graphic novel Endangered Weapon B and around a hundred short stories, comic and film scripts.
